Like the line the Frenzy gives you. Opinion please what I could expect for fresh medium.
14mph, low rev, high track. Any rec's on drilling PAP 51/2X3/4up for good length angular B/E
If possible comparison to your ball movement.
Thanks
If you watch the video for the Thrash Frenzy during the league segment,you see lanes that are freshly oiled medium volume.The house is really hot and the heating vents are about 6' behind the approaches.You can feel the heat blowing towards the lanes when you stand on the approach.Also,they keep the oiling machine near the outside walls in an colder area.What this does is make the oil come out slower which means less oil.
So you can expect the ball to get through the front part of the lane before making it's move.I have yet to get any drastic overreaction on that shot.
